2026 Blackfin 222 CC
About This Yacht
The 2026 Blackfin 222 CC is a 21.5-foot center console built on a fiberglass hull with a deep-V design and 20° deadrise, engineered for both offshore capability and a dry ride through choppy conditions. The 8.5-foot beam and variable deadrise hull provide stability and predictable handling, while the shallow 18-inch engine-up draft allows flexibility between inshore and blue-water fishing. Finished in all-black, the boat presents a striking, modern appearance with premium stainless hardware throughout.
Power comes from a single Mercury 250 hp outboard—a high-torque four-stroke offering strong acceleration and planing characteristics with efficient cruising in the 30–40 mph range. The 105-gallon fuel tank provides substantial range for all-day offshore pursuits. The boat reaches speeds in the low-to-mid 50s mph and delivers smooth, quiet operation with Mercury's advanced fuel-injection and digital controls.
The deck layout centers around fishing and day-cruising comfort. Features include an 18-gallon aerated livewell with light, insulated fish boxes, abundant rod storage, and a deluxe leaning post with flip-down bolsters and molded footrests. The bow offers removable seating cushions, and the cockpit includes a molded table. A swim platform with ladder rounds out the recreational amenities. The helm is ergonomically designed with room for up to nine passengers overall.
The boat comes with a custom-welded Ameritrail aluminum trailer fitted with torsion axles, disc brakes, and tailored bunks for secure launching and towing.
